Transaction 95992a5b35623233a95b44875ff2a317676f076e60bfeb716a3f8324679079e7

1 Input
2 Outputs
  • 95992a5b35623233a95b44875ff2a317676f076e60bfeb716a3f8324679079e7:0
  • value  34357
    address  3JWpqNEBeUWxdLm19jLFpQrc1235uDswDW
  • 95992a5b35623233a95b44875ff2a317676f076e60bfeb716a3f8324679079e7:1
  • value  340865
    address  1CmwKMbRDYyiMAWs9eBuaFpkbHSsHHhVJC